Transaction 4260d5dcccfaa618a7f23d6bb1873607f6bd6068e131604d6d3f505d58c0e8a8
1 Input
1 Output
-
4260d5dcccfaa618a7f23d6bb1873607f6bd6068e131604d6d3f505d58c0e8a8:0
- value
- 354367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08c36424977ccdf62fda95065be014143e0b3670 OP_EQUAL
- address
- 32VMQ6WbDFYgqjz887yAtu7bSJRv99m39S